Comment #4 on issue 435 by guilleguti84: Assisted Inject uses child  
injector to bind args
http://code.google.com/p/google-guice/issues/detail?id=435

A quick update. We had a bottleneck in an Assisted Inject, and we were able  
to remove
the bottleneck and made it like 200 times faster by replacing the
FactoryProvider.newFactory(Whatever.class) inside the Module with a bind to  
our own
implementation of that factory (that just get the instances of the  
dependencies and
call the constructor).

By changing that the time inside the Inject was so small that the lock was  
almost
unnoticeable.

--
You received this message because you are listed in the owner
or CC fields of this issue, or because you starred this issue.
You may adjust your issue notification preferences at:
http://code.google.com/hosting/settings

--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"google-guice-dev" group.
To post to this group, send email to [email protected]
To unsubscribe from this group, send email to 
[email protected]
For more options, visit this group at 
http://groups.google.com/group/google-guice-dev?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to